Description (IGDB)

In 2180, the Joint Forces of Earth come under attack from the mysterious Brain Forces. After an initial victory by the J.F.E., the Core Brain, the central unit of the Brain Forces, begins closing in from lightyears away. The player takes control of the prototype starfighter Caesar, built specially to counter the threat of the Brain Forces, and must defeat the Core Brain and save humanity.

Critiques de la Presse (Metacritic)

Cubed3 80/100

« This 'Caravan Mode' version of Star Soldier is perfect for those that cannot commit to working their way through a full shmup outing. »

Worth Playing 80/100

« Ultimately, Star Soldier R is an excellent little game if you're a shooter fan and a high score junkie who sorely misses the 16-bit era and its corresponding 2-D style of play. Make no mistake, this is a game with somewhat limited appeal, and if you're not in the target audience, it's likely to register a pretty quick "meh" and get passed over for something new. »

Official Nintendo Magazine UK 79/100

« Only fun for a quick fix. [July 2008, p.101] »

GameDaily 70/100

« Star Soldier R could've been so much more, with at least five or six more levels, a difficulty curve and two-player interactivity. As it stands, though, it's surprisingly fun. »

NintendoWorldReport 70/100

« The WiiWare game is a different experience, and a rewarding one at that, provided you understand what it is you're getting into beforehand. You'll find R to be a pretty fun game if you do. »

GameSpot 70/100

« This is a satisfying hardcore title to help launch the WiiWare service. »

Cheat Code Central 70/100

« As for Star Soldier R in particular, it is certainly a decent game. Is it worth the price of admission? Maybe, it all depends on how entertaining you find trying to break high scores »

GamePro 70/100

« Some may not appreciate Star Soldier R's replay-intensive gameplay, and may view the game as something that can be seen in its entirety in less than ten minutes. It's a fun ten minutes, though, and assuming you're willing to accept it for what it is, your Wii Points will be well-spent. »
